The core concept revolves around a multiplier that continuously increases over time. Players place bets and, before the “crash” occurs, cash out to secure their winnings multiplied by the current multiplier. The longer you wait, the higher the potential payout, but also the greater the risk of losing your entire stake. This inherent risk-reward dynamic is what makes it so captivating. Successful participation isn’t purely luck-based; it requires understanding probability, risk management, and, importantly, recognizing your own risk tolerance. The relatively simple rules hide a surprisingly complex set of strategies that can be employed to maximize potential gains and minimize losses.

The Role of the Provably Fair System
The provably fair system is a key differentiator. It uses cryptographic hashing and seed values, both contributed by the server and the client (player), to determine the outcome. This prevents the operator from manipulating the results. Players can view these seeds and the hashing process, independently verifying that the game is truly random. This level of transparency provides a significant advantage over traditional online casino games, fostering player confidence and trust. It’s important to research how each platform implements provably fair technology, as variations exist, but the underlying principle remains the same: verifiable randomness.

Martingale and Anti-Martingale Systems
The Martingale system involves doubling your bet after each loss, with the expectation that when you eventually win, you’ll recoup all previous losses plus a small profit. While theoretically sound, it requires a substantial bankroll to withstand a prolonged losing streak. The Anti-Martingale system, conversely, involves increasing your bet after each win. This approach capitalizes on winning streaks but can be quickly depleted during losing streaks. Both systems are high-risk, high-reward and demand careful bankroll management. It's vital to understand the potential downsides before implementing either of these strategies.

Setting Stop-Loss and Take-Profit Limits
A stop-loss limit is a predetermined amount of money you’re willing to lose in a single session. Once you reach this limit, you stop playing, regardless of your emotional state. A take-profit limit is the amount you aim to win before stopping for the session. This helps to lock in profits and prevent you from losing them back to the house. These limits are essential for protecting your bankroll and maintaining a disciplined approach. Consistently adhering to these limits is far more important than any specific betting strategy.
